One of the reasons I like Quinlan and Fox as a duo is because they're opposites in terms of how they want people to view them and how people ACTUALLY view them.
Fox is smarter than anyone realizes and kinder than he wants anyone to know.
Quinlan is kinder than anyone realizes and smarter than he wants anyone to know.
Fox would suffer from the public perception of the clones as a mass developed product more than a person, and while fandom tends to see him as a bit of a hardass who prioritizes his job over everything else, the few scenes we get with him show him being lenient towards some droids, emotional about the deaths of his men, and empathizing with Ahsoka's anger at someone who bombed her home. So I think a lot of people would think he's not all that intelligent, and one of the ways Fox deals with the stresses of his day-to-day life is by projecting a very professional distant persona to keep anyone from getting too close.
Quinlan on the other hand I think intentionally wants people to underestimate him because of the work that he does, he wants people to think he's a bit of a loose cannon who barely knows what he's doing and flies by the seat of his pants, improvising as he goes. If people think he's a bit of an idiot, he can probably get away with a lot more than if they know just how clever and observant he actually is. But that image he projects of someone who's more of a loose cannon also seems to come across as someone who just doesn't care all that much about anyone or anything, despite how deeply he clearly does care about people and about his work, almost to a fault.
And I think that's part of what would draw them to each other, the ability to see through both their public perception and the persona they intentionally project. They can see each other clearly because they're kindred spirits even if they're opposites at the same time.
